PersonRemove: відмінності між версіями

Матеріал з expertsolution
Перейти до навігації Перейти до пошуку
Немає опису редагування
Немає опису редагування
 
Рядок 38: Рядок 38:
<syntaxhighlight lang="json">
<syntaxhighlight lang="json">
{
{
     "PersonID": 5130
     "PersonID": 5130,
    "DeactivateCard":  true
}
}


Рядок 56: Рядок 57:
| Int
| Int
| ID персони з методу </span>[https://wiki.expertsolution.com.ua/index.php?title=GetDiscountCardInfo GetDiscountCardInfo ]</span>
| ID персони з методу </span>[https://wiki.expertsolution.com.ua/index.php?title=GetDiscountCardInfo GetDiscountCardInfo ]</span>
|-
|
| DeactivateCard
| Bool
| true - лише деактивує карту без видалення даних по персоні <br>
false - видаляє дані по персоні
|-
|-
!style="width:50%; background:#accae4;" scope="row" colspan="4"| * Позначення обов’язкового параметру
!style="width:50%; background:#accae4;" scope="row" colspan="4"| * Позначення обов’язкового параметру

Поточна версія на 09:36, 12 лютого 2026

Функція видаляє персону

Розділ містить методи, необхідні для видалення персони


Опис Видалення персони.
Метод POST
URL /POSExternal/PersonRemove



Request Headers
KEY VALUE
Content-Type application/json
AccessToken



Body raw (json)
{
    "PersonID": 5130,
    "DeactivateCard":  true 
}


Типи даних Body
* Параметр Тип Опис
PersonID Int ID персони з методу GetDiscountCardInfo
DeactivateCard Bool true - лише деактивує карту без видалення даних по персоні

false - видаляє дані по персоні

* Позначення обов’язкового параметру



Response (json)
{
    "Error": "",
    "Success": true,
    "ClientTime": "/Date(1765973820559+0200)/",
    "ErrorCode": 0
}



Типи даних Response
* Параметр Тип Опис
Error String [] Опис помилки, що виникла
Success Bool Успіх виконання запиту
* Позначення обов’язкового параметру
Додатковий опис вхідних параметрів